Reba McEntire Reveals She’ll Sing In ‘Happy’s Place’; Theme Song In Works

Reba McEntire will be singing on Happy’s Place and revealed she is working on the theme song.

“It’s written, and we’re recording it at the end of this month,” McEntire said at the 2024 Summer Television Critics Association Press Tour about the show’s theme song. Hope you like it.”

McEntire sang the “I’m a Survivor” theme song of her 2001 sitcom Reba, which recently took a life of its own, becoming a trending audio on TikTok.

In Happy’s Place, McEntire plays Bobbie, who inherits her father’s restaurant and is less than thrilled to discover that she has a new business partner in her half-sister Isabella, played by Belissa Escobedo, whom she never knew she had.

McEntire’s musical talents will also be used within the show, as she revealed there’s a stage in the tavern where the series takes place with room for the singer to perform. With McEntire returning to The Voice as a coach, she revealed that Season 26 coaches Michael Bublé and Snoop Dogg have expressed interest in making guest appearances on the sitcom.

Happy’s Place also reunites McEntire with her Reba co-star Melissa Peterman. The sitcom also stars Pablo Castelblanco, Tokala Black Elk and Rex Linn.

Writer Kevin Abbott executive produces with Michael Hanel, Mindy Schultheis, Julie Abbott and Reba McEntire. Happy’s Place is produced by Universal Television, a division of Universal Studio Group.

Happy’s Place premieres on NBC on Friday, October 18 at 8 p.m. ET/PT.
